How is the grade for Stationsbuurt calculated?

Stationsbuurt scores 4.8 overall. That is a weighted average of five pillars: safety, amenities, housing, social & income, and nature & quiet. Each pillar compares this neighbourhood with every other neighbourhood in the Netherlands, using open data from CBS and the police.

Is Stationsbuurt a safe neighbourhood?

Stationsbuurt scores 2.8 on safety, based on registered crimes per 1,000 people present (63.5 per year). The national median is around 24.1.
